Basic Action

You assume the form of another creature. You must build a variant for for yourself using your normal points and limits. This creature cannot have any skill value higher than yours. You can add powers of the same form the creature has and keep schticks and powers you already have, but you cannot otherwise add powers or schticks.

You remain in this form until you fall asleep or unconscious or will yourself back to your normal form (a Basic Action).

You can learn this power several times to learn to transform into several different kinds of creatures. There is a limit on what forms you can assume if you use an ability that lets you temporarily learn new powers, such as Form Mastery or Spell preparation. Each time you temporarily gain this power, you transform into the same type of creature.
